ALCPT Form 119 is a standardized, multiple-choice examination developed by the Defense Language Institute English Language Center (DLIELC) at Lackland Air Force Base. It serves as an official placement and screening mechanism to determine if candidates possess the language capabilities required to attend military training, technical courses, or professional development programs in English-speaking environments.
